Optimism.

Yes, it's amazing what a difference three points can make.

After a tough week at The Den, Saturday lunchtime's hard-fought win at Kenilworth Road answered a few questions that were hanging over this squad.

Of course this game was never going to be an extravaganza of free-flowing open play. And it certainly wasn't.

But if you're going to have a hard ground 1-0 result, then you want to be on the winning side of that scoreline.

And thanks to an excellent ball from our highly rated prospect Ra'ees Bangura-Williams to club record signing Mihailo Ivanovic, the issue was settled with his fantastic ball control and a 25-yard dipping strike into the bottom left corner.

A wonderful moment of skill to make up for a missed penalty earlier by another decent looking signing in Aaron Connolly.

On the down side, the Lions' injury crisis continues to mount with both Calum Scanlon and goalkeeper Lukas Jensen substituted after being hurt, both joining an ever-lengthening medical list that leaves us worryingly short in some areas.

But with a decent away win and some sterling performances by the likes of new signing Tristan Crama, Japhet Tanganga and Casper De Norre, Millwall can travel to relegation rivals Portsmouth tomorrow night feeling that 'O' word is stirring again in South Bermondsey.
